What happened
An arXiv RSS batch of new stat-ML papers (Apr 28, 2026) covering methods and theory for high-dimensional optimization, clustering, causal inference, kernel and spectral learning, neural-network representations, online second-order inference, probabilistic graphical models for Bayesian inversion, semi-supervised classification, regularized optimal transport, and score-based reduced-order stochastic modeling.
